Overview: NCP398 USB Type-C VCONN Overvoltage Protection IC The NCP398 is an overvoltage protection device. It protects VCONN against overvoltages in applications where VCONN is directly derived from the VBUS supply. At power up, the integrated power MOSFET is automatically controlled to reduce inrush current. The IC continuously monitors undervoltage, overvoltage and thermal events. In case of overvoltage, a very high speed comparator opens the power MOSFET instantaneously. The part is enabled through the EN pin. A high level on this pin allows forcing off the internal switch and drastically decreases the current consumption of the NCP398 core.
